EDINBURG, Texas (ValleyCentral) — South Texas Health System Edinburg has been named a Best Regional Hospital in Texas for a third consecutive year by U.S. News & World Report.

The hospital's news release stated it made the annual list of top hospitals for its performance in providing complex care across multiple medical specialties.

Coming in at No. 23 in the state, STHS Edinburg is the only hospital in the Rio Grande Valley to make the list which helps patients and their doctors make more informed decisions about where to receive medical care for challenging health conditions and common elective procedures.

In the summer of 2022, STHS Edinburg doubled in size with the addition of a $104 million five-story patient tower to meet the community’s growing health care needs. It is part of the elite 11% of the 4,500 hospitals evaluated across the United States that earned a numerical ranking.

“It’s an honor to be the only hospital in the Rio Grande Valley to be named a Best Regional Hospital by such a prestigious magazine for the third year in a row. It serves as testament to our dedication to quality, compassionate care to our patients at the highest level while striving to achieve the best patient outcomes and a positive experience for those who entrust us with their care,” says Lance Ames, Chief Executive Officer, South Texas Health System Edinburg & STHS Children’s.

STHS Edinburg was recognized for its high performance in seven common procedures or conditions: heart failure, ch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D), diabetes, heart attack, kidney failure, pneumonia, and stroke.

The magazine’s evaluation of STHS Edinburg included data from the facility; its three other acute care facilities: STHS McAllen, STHS Children’s, and STHS Heart; and its behavioral health facility: STHS Behavioral, the news release stated.
